Job Summary :
The selected candidate will be responsible for performing service operations including repair and troubleshooting functions to component level on complex electro-optical equipment.
Position requires set-up and calibration tasks; building and troubleshooting of systems; as well as performing rework and quality testing related to the production of parts, components, subassemblies and final assemblies.
Determines and may assist in developing methods and procedures to control or modify the customer service process and continued process improvements.
Primary Duties & Responsibilities :
Include but not limited to diagnosis, service repair and upgrades to all product lines
